So, what is negative multiplication? Simply put, it's the process of multiplying two negative numbers or a negative number by a positive number. When you multiply two negative numbers together, the result is a positive number. For example, -3 * -4 = 12. When you multiply a negative number by a positive number, the result is a negative number, as in -3 * 4 = -12.
